Brief description
Plate of soft-paste porcelain painted with enamels and gilded, Derby Porcelain factory, Derby, ca. 1800.
Physical description
Plate of soft-paste porcelain painted with enamels and gilded. Octagonal and decorated with sprays of Chinese flowers in pink, blue and two shades of green enamel. Gilt edge.
